Three people have fallen through the ice in central Stockholm. The incident occurred on the ice near Norr Mälarstrand, at a location where a broken ice channel had formed, leaving open water exposed. According to the rescue service, hundreds of people were out walking on the ice at the time of the accident. Marie Nordahl from the rescue service spoke to Expressen about the situation. She stated, "There are very many people out on the ice, very many." The three individuals who fell through the ice were helped out of the water by private citizens who were nearby. They were examined on site by ambulance personnel. No further details about their condition were provided in the source. The presence of so many people on the ice highlights the common winter activity of walking on frozen waterways in Stockholm. Norr Mälarstrand is a well-known area where residents and visitors often gather during cold periods to walk on the ice. The formation of broken ice channels creates dangerous conditions. In this case, the open water within the ice field led directly to the accident. Emergency services responded to the scene, but initial assistance came entirely from bystanders. The event underscores the risks associated with walking on urban ice when its thickness and stability are uncertain.
